Design Confidentiality and Authenticated Cryptosystems for Wireless Communication Network – Evidence from Coast Guard Administration / 設計具機密性及身分認證之無線通訊網-以行政院海岸巡防署為例

碩士 / 國防大學管理學院 / 資訊管理學系 / 99 / The assignment is so diverse and special in Coast Guard Task, how to use wireless communication network safely and transmitted various intelligence to the duty execution of front line, a major accident in sea area (shore) and to execute combined rescue missions, provide the movable communication services between the different departments or units, give assistance and support each other, in fact, the implementation of key point for enhance the effectiveness. In this paper, we proposed a new concept of using elliptic curve cryptography, it have basic security requirement except the confidentiality, verifiability, and not be denied, the network is still able to cope with the attack on the common. This study has the following four advantages: (1) build up the fast and authentication mechanism. (2) doesn’t need the certificate centers participated the certification online in communication phase. (3) comply with the confidentiality, integrity, authenticity and non-repudiation of other basic security needs. (4) provide the movable communication services between the different departments or units (across the network). (5) the ciphertext to be an avalanche effect.
